CL_DEVICE_MAX_WORK_ITEM_SIZES :线程分组的尺寸限制
CL_DEVICE_MAX_WORK_GROUP_SIZE:线程分组中所能包含的最大线程数
Thread blocks have maximum dimensions: CL_DEVICE_MAX_WORK_ITEM_SIZES,Think of laying out your threads in a grid, you can't have a row with more than 512 threads. You can't have a column with more than 512 threads. And you can't stack more than 64 threads high. Next, there is a maximum: CL_DEVICE_MAX_WORK_GROUP_SIZE number of threads, 512, that can be grouped together in a block. So your thread blocks dimensions could be:
512 x 1 x 1
1 x 512 x 1
4 x 2 x 64
64 x 8 x 1
etc...
参考地址:
http://stackoverflow.com/questions/3606636/cuda-model-what-is-warp-size